Dharam Buddhi is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Dharam Buddhi has authored 66 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 18 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 14 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Dharam Buddhi’s work include Advanced machining processes and optimization (12 papers), Advanced Machining and Optimization Techniques (10 papers) and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(9 papers). Dharam Buddhi is often cited by papers focused on Advanced machining processes and optimization (12 papers), Advanced Machining and Optimization Techniques (10 papers) and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(9 papers). Dharam Buddhi collaborates with scholars based in India, Iraq and Russia. Dharam Buddhi's co-authors include Chander Prakash, Saurav Dixit, Kuldeep K. Saxena, Sohini Chowdhury, N. Yadaiah, Seeram Ramakrishna, Lovi Raj Gupta, S. Shankar, Alokesh Pramanik and Animesh Kumar Basak and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Cleaner Production, Journal of Environmental Management and Applied Thermal Engineering.
